YZYBIO-B Interim 2026: Net Loss Shrinks to RMB6.26 Million on Milestone Licensing Income and Sharp R&D Cut

Wuhan YZY Biopharma Co., Ltd. (YZYBIO-B) reported its unaudited results for the six months ended 30 June 2026. Revenue dipped 10.9% year-on-year to RMB33.14 million, yet gross profit surged to RMB25.26 million from RMB7.67 million on a lighter cost base.

Licensing fees from the CT Tianqing collaboration on core product M701 contributed RMB24.23 million, or 73.1% of total revenue, following achievement of a development milestone. R&D service income generated RMB8.92 million, representing 26.9%.

Operating expenses contracted markedly. Research and development spending fell 70.8% to RMB17.58 million, driven by lower third-party service fees and reduced raw-material usage. Administrative expenses were broadly stable at RMB13.41 million. Finance costs declined 12.7% to RMB2.08 million.

The company recorded a pre-tax and net loss of RMB6.26 million, versus a RMB58.83 million loss a year earlier. Net liabilities stood at RMB58.56 million at period-end, compared with RMB53.03 million as of 31 December 2025. Cash and cash equivalents fell to RMB75.99 million, mainly due to RMB26.63 million operating cash outflow and RMB5.16 million capital expenditure; outstanding bank borrowings rose to RMB138.62 million.

Pipeline highlights included National Medical Products Administration acceptance of the M701 new-drug application for malignant ascites and FDA clearance of an IND for malignant pleural effusion. Four clinical-stage and two pre-clinical assets remain in development.

The board declared no interim dividend.
